Output 26b656462b9d7f135f1cb2b6da8276db22054667f286e743bfef1a8366a5ce3a:0

value
358191
script pubkey
OP_0 OP_PUSHBYTES_20 aa921d684158dcce031d790307f6bee42b0fc813
address
bc1q42fp66zptrwvuqca0yps0a47us4sljqnl855k5
transaction
26b656462b9d7f135f1cb2b6da8276db22054667f286e743bfef1a8366a5ce3a
confirmations
284919
spent
true